Senior Manager, Cyber Security Operations Center
About the role
The Senior Manager, Cyber Security Operations Center (SOC) oversees 24/7 global security monitoring, threat detection, and incident response across Digital Realty’s IT, OT, cloud, and product platform environments. This role drives operational excellence within a high-tempo global SOC, balancing decisive incident response with long-term detection engineering, automation, and program maturity.
Responsibilities
- Lead day-to-day operations of a 24x7 global SOC using follow-the-sun and fusion center operational models.
- Oversee real-time monitoring, triage, escalation, and resolution of security events across enterprise IT, OT, cloud, and edge platforms.
- Direct major cyber incident response efforts end-to-end, coordinating containment, eradication, recovery, and post-incident analysis.
- Own and continuously optimize SOC tooling including SIEM, SOAR, EDR/MDE, NDR, vulnerability management, and case management platforms.
- Drive detection engineering, threat hunting, and intelligence integration to improve alert quality and adversary visibility.
- Partner cross-functionally with IT, OT, Product, Legal, Compliance, Risk, and Operations during high-impact incidents.
- Own SOC KPIs including MTTD, MTTR, detection coverage, and alert fidelity, reporting outcomes to executive leadership.
- Lead the SOC technology modernization roadmap including automation, enrichment, and machine-assisted detection capabilities.
Requirements
- 8–12+ years of cybersecurity experience with at least 5 years in security operations or incident response leadership roles.
- Deep technical expertise across SIEM/SOAR, EDR, NDR, cloud security monitoring, and log analytics platforms.
- Strong working knowledge of Microsoft security tools and ecosystem.
- Proven experience managing significant cyber incidents in complex, global environments.
- Solid understanding of IT, OT, and cloud architectures and operational risk.
- Experience aligning SOC operations with regulatory and compliance frameworks including NIST, ISO 27001, SOC 2, NIS2, DORA, PCI, SOX, and GDPR.
- Demonstrated success building, scaling, and mentoring high-performing global security teams.
- Professional certifications such as CISSP, CISM, or GIAC strongly preferred.
